SEC Commissioner Peirce Sounds Alarm on DeFi Lending Risks

Hester Peirce warns that some automated lending platforms might be crossing the line into regulated securities territory.

SEC Commissioner Hester Peirce recently shared a caution for the DeFi sector. She suggested that certain onchain vaults and automated lending protocols could be viewed as investment funds or advisory services. If these platforms operate like traditional investment vehicles, they might eventually fall under existing securities regulations.

The core of the issue involves how these protocols are structured. Peirce noted that when users pool assets and rely on the management of others to generate returns, the setup looks very similar to established financial products that require federal registration. This is a significant point for developers who want to keep their projects decentralized while avoiding legal friction.

For investors and builders, this highlights a potential shift in how regulators approach decentralized finance. While nothing has changed today, the message suggests that the SEC is watching how these vaults handle funds. Traders should keep an eye on future regulatory guidance to see if their favorite protocols need to make big changes to stay compliant.
